## Deploying the Gatewick Proctor Queue

Deploys are pretty painless: push to main, wait for the pipeline, then watch the queue drain dashboard for five minutes. If candidates pile up mid-exam, roll back first and ask questions later — the queue replays safely. Everything the workers care about lives in one config block, shown here for reference.

settings of bafof-yagef:
JOROX_PIN=8740
JOROX_TENANT=pelox
JOROX_METRICS_HOST=metrics.jorox.qorvelworks.internal
JOROX_SEAL=seal_c78f63c1
JOROX_STANDBY_TEAM=norax

Subject: Cut-over complete — Slatebell timetable solver

Cut-over to the new Slatebell solver finished last night. Old scheduler decommissioned; all school timetable jobs now route through the v2 queue. No credentials were migrated; service accounts were reissued. Audit logging is enabled from first boot. For your review, the production configuration now in effect is as follows.

config for yajep-tafof:
[rusath]
team = julmir
access_code = ac_fe37fd
host = rusath.novactech.test
port = 8000
owner = pelmir.weneth
peer = oliwyn.olvarqdyn.internal

Subject: Quickstore 4.2 — bloom filter now fronts the KV layer

Plugin authors: starting with this release, Quickstore places a bloom filter ahead of the key-value store. Negative lookups return faster; false positives fall through safely. No API changes are required on your side. Verify your plugin against the staging build referenced below.

session token of fahif-tadup = htk3_9c7